Woodrow Wilson and Millikan are an even 5-5 against one another since January of 2020, but not for long. The Woodrow Wilson Bruins will host the Millikan Rams at 5:30 p.m. on Friday. Woodrow Wilson will be strutting in after a win while Millikan will be coming in after a loss.
Woodrow Wilson is headed into the game after thoroughly thrashing Compton: they outscored them in every quarter. Given that consistent dominance, it should come as no surprise that Woodrow Wilson blew Compton out of the water with a 64-33 final score. The Bruins pushed the score to 51-21 by the end of the third, a deficit the Tarbabes had little chance of recovering from.
Meanwhile, Millikan lost to Jordan at home by a 38-24 margin on Wednesday. The Rams have now taken an 'L' in back-to-back games.
Millikan's defeat ended a four-game streak of wins at home and dropped them to 11-12. As for Woodrow Wilson, their victory bumped their record up to 8-9.
